Title: Resident Evil: Retribution (IMDb)
Starring: Milla Jovovich
Released: 21st December 2012
SRP: $30.99 (DVD)
Further Details:
Sony Pictures Home Entertainment has announced DVD ($30.99), Blu-ray ($35.99), and 3D Blu-ray ($45.99) releases of Resident Evil: Retribution for December 21st. Extras on the DVD will include commentary with Writer/Director Paul W.S. Anderson, Milla Jovovich and Boris Kodjoe, a second commentary with Writer/Director Paul W.S. Anderson and Producer Jeremy Bolt. featurettes ("Drop (Un) Dead: The Creatures of Retribution", "Retribution - Face of the Fan", "Retribution Soundtrack"), and outtakes. The Blu-ray releases will also include Deleted and Extended Scenes, Project Alice: The Interactive Database, and additional featurettes ("Evolving Alice", "Resident Evil: Reunion", "Into the Lion's Den", "Resident Stuntman", "Maestro of Evil: Directing Resident Evil: Retribution").
